The Battlefield: Where Terrorists Clash with Counter-Terrorists

CS:GO revolves around a classic premise: terrorists versus counter-terrorists. Players are divided into two opposing teams, each with distinct objectives.

  • Terrorists: Their goal is to plant and detonate a bomb at designated sites within the map. They can also win by eliminating all enemy players.
  • Counter-Terrorists: Their primary objective is to prevent the terrorists from planting the bomb or defusing it if it’s already planted.

This simple setup belies the immense depth and strategic complexity of CS:GO. Every round is a tense chess match, where positioning, communication, and precise aim are paramount. Players must master the map layouts, learn the nuances of each weapon, and develop an understanding of their teammate’s playstyles to emerge victorious.

The Arsenal: A Symphony of Weaponry

CS:GO boasts a diverse arsenal of weapons, each with its unique characteristics and role in combat.

Weapon Type Examples Strengths Weaknesses
Pistols Glock-18, USP-S, Desert Eagle Versatile, affordable Limited range, lower damage
Submachine Guns MP9, MAC-10, UMP-45 High fire rate, good for close quarters Inaccurate at long ranges
Rifles AK-47, M4A4, FAMAS Powerful, accurate at medium to long range More expensive
Shotguns Nova, XM1014 Devastating at close range Limited effective range
Sniper Rifles AWP, SSG 08 Long-range precision Slow fire rate, requires good aim

The choice of weapon can significantly influence a player’s strategy and approach. A skilled AWPer (AWP sniper) can dictate the pace of the game from afar, while a rushing SMG user might focus on close-quarters engagements.

The Maps: Arenas of Tactical Conflict

CS:GO features a variety of maps, each with its own unique layout, challenges, and opportunities. Some maps are designed for close-quarters combat (like Dust II or Inferno), while others favor long-range engagements (like Mirage or Cache).

Each map has multiple bomb sites, strategically placed chokepoints, and flanking routes, encouraging players to adapt their strategies based on the environment. Experienced CS:GO players often memorize the intricate details of each map, including common hiding spots, grenade trajectories, and optimal positioning for specific weapons.

Beyond the Gameplay: A Thriving Ecosystem

CS:GO’s impact extends far beyond its core gameplay. It has fostered a vibrant competitive scene with professional teams battling it out in international tournaments. The game’s popularity has also fueled a thriving content creation industry, with countless streamers and YouTubers sharing their gameplay, strategies, and highlights.

Moreover, CS:GO’s modding community constantly adds new maps, skins, and game modes, keeping the experience fresh and exciting for long-term players.
